Get Your Adult Drivers License in Texas Earning your Texas drivers license as an adult is a cinch – it’s easy at 1-2-3. STEP 1: Sign up for an adult drivers ed course If you’re between the ages of 18-24, the state of Texas requires you to take a drivers ed course before applying for a Texas drivers license.

If you’re a Texas adult 25 and older, a drivers ed course is not required. However, if you take an adult drivers ed course, you can bypass the written exam completely when you go to the DPS office – the final exam for your course counts as the DPS written exam.
STEP 2: Receive your certificate of completion After you take our 6-hour drivers ed course, you’ll need to pass our final exam: 30 multiple-choice questions on road signs and rules. Don’t stress – you have 3 attempts to get a passing grade (70% or higher). After you pass, simply complete the, and it’s off to the DPS for your final tests.
STEP 3: Go to your local DPS office Make a road test appointment at your local DPS office. If you’re 18-24 years old, you will be required to present your completion certificate, and pass vision and hearing exams before taking your road test.
Remember, if you’re a Texas adult 25 or older and have not taken a drivers ed course, you are required to take a written exam as well. You may also request a permit to practice driving with a person 21 years or older and who have had their license in Texas for at least one year. This can be done prior to completing and the road test.
